Summary of Testosterone



Testosterone, a vital hormonal agent in the human body, plays an essential duty in different physiological procedures, including muscle advancement, bone density, and general physical performance. Mostly produced in the testes in men and in smaller quantities in the ovaries and adrenal glands in females, testosterone is categorized as an androgen, a sort of steroid hormonal agent. Its synthesis is regulated by a comments loophole including the hypothalamus, pituitary gland, and the gonads.


The value of testosterone prolongs past reproductive health; it affects state of mind, energy degrees, and cognitive features. Ideal testosterone degrees are important for preserving a healthy libido, advertising fat circulation, and supporting muscle mass toughness. As individuals age, testosterone degrees normally decline, commonly leading to different wellness issues, including lowered physical performance, tiredness, and lowered bone density.


Comprehending testosterone's complex role in the human body is essential for recognizing its effect on general wellness and performance. Clinicians often analyze testosterone levels in people experiencing signs and symptoms connected with reduced testosterone, referred to as hypogonadism. Keeping balanced testosterone levels is essential for promoting wellness and improving physical capacities throughout various life stages.


Impact on Muscle Mass Development



A substantial correlation exists between testosterone levels and muscle mass development, highlighting the hormonal agent's crucial role in promoting anabolic processes within the body. Testosterone assists in healthy protein synthesis, which is crucial for muscle hypertrophy. Elevated testosterone levels boost the body's capacity to fix and develop muscle tissue following resistance training, an essential element of muscle mass growth.


Research indicates that individuals with higher testosterone degrees typically show raised muscular tissue mass and toughness contrasted to those with lower levels. This relationship is specifically noticeable in men, as they normally have higher testosterone concentrations than women. Furthermore, testosterone's impact prolongs past straight muscle-building impacts; it also regulates aspects such as satellite cell activity, which is vital for muscular tissue regrowth and growth.

Factors Influencing Testosterone Levels



Many factors can affect testosterone levels, affecting not just hormonal equilibrium but additionally sports efficiency. Age is a considerable determinant, as testosterone degrees normally peak in very early their adult years and decline with advancing age. is 1 ml of testosterone a week enough. Way of life choices also play a crucial role; for example, normal exercise, particularly resistance training, has been revealed to elevate testosterone degrees, while less active actions can bring about declines




Nutritional behaviors are just as prominent. Nutrient shortages, specifically in zinc and vitamin D, have actually been linked to lower testosterone levels. Body structure is important; people with greater body fat percentages typically experience lowered testosterone degrees due to the conversion of testosterone to estrogen in adipose tissue.


Emotional factors, including tension and review rest quality, can not be ignored, as chronic stress and anxiety raises cortisol levels, negatively impacting testosterone manufacturing. Understanding these impacts is essential for establishing comprehensive approaches to enhance testosterone levels in grownups.
